About this property
Castle Hotel
Hotel in Neath with a coffee shop and free breakfast
Castle Hotel offers 30 accommodations with coffee/tea makers and hair dryers. These individually decorated and furnished accommodations include desks. Beds feature premium bedding. Satellite television is provided.
This Neath h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Additionally, rooms include complimentary toiletries and blackout drapes/curtains. Housekeeping is offered daily and irons/ironing boards can be requested.
The recreational activities listed below are available either on site or nearby; fees may apply.
Make yourself at home in one of the 30 individually decorated gu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, and housekeeping is provided daily.
Take in the views from a terrace and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and wedding services. This hotel also features a television in a common area and a banquet hall.
Satisfy your appetite at the hotel's coffee shop/cafe, or stay in and take advantage of the 24-hour room service.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ary continental breakfast is served on weekdays from 7:00 AM to 9:00 AM and on weekends from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.
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k, multilingual staff, and luggage storage. This hotel has 3 meeting rooms available for events. Free self parking is available onsite.
